The IRD Model 970i is a rugged, low impedance accelerometer for use with portable instruments on all types of industrial equipment. The Model 970i incorporates the industry standard IEPE constant current interface. This is a low-output impedance, constant-current drive amplifier with a lownoise floor. The 970i design is based on the proven performance of the IRD Model 970 accelerometer. The Model 970i is sealed against dust and moisture and operates up to a temperature of 250° F (121°C). A single ¼ - 28 mounting stud is used for attaching the accelerometer to a flat surface. Insulated mounting adapters are available for those cases where ground potential problems may exist between the transducer mounting surface and the instrument.
